We have made a significant investment into the module and we are confident that is the right investment at the right time for this market. eRx Connect is different from the major pharmacy networks in that eRx Connect provides a direct connection with compounding pharmacies. This connection allows prescribers to create prescriptions by directly using the compounding pharmacy’s formulary which avoids the tedious task of creating and managing formulary entries in traditional e-prescribing tools. This capability saves time and ensures precise communication with pharmacies. For pharmacies that do not use the Compounder Rx by PCCA, eRx Connect can still deliver prescriptions to them by secure fax. And while the system is optimized for compound medications, the system contains a standard drug database and a listing of over 75,000 pharmacies nationwide for prescribing standard medications from regular retail pharmacies.
